diff options
author | Noah Levitt <nlevitt@columbia.edu> | 2004-02-23 02:19:13 +0000 |
---|---|---|
committer | Noah Levitt <nlevitt@src.gnome.org> | 2004-02-23 02:19:13 +0000 |
commit | d2c50eca978828bbf7c3b0386da35ee1444a64f7 (patch) | |
tree | 1ea1796a8b9e983c8d59e3e25bec9301becd20db /pango/pango-font.h | |
parent | 2d82bfe6db3fe0a70df8c6381eb5dfb150724881 (diff) | |
download | pango-d2c50eca978828bbf7c3b0386da35ee1444a64f7.tar.gz |
New API for getting available sizes for a bitmap font face.
2003-02-22 Noah Levitt <nlevitt@columbia.edu>
* pango/pango-font.h:
* pango/pangofc-fontmap.c:
* pango/pangowin32-fontmap.c:
* pango/fonts.c (pango_font_face_list_sizes): New API for
getting available sizes for a bitmap font face.
Diffstat (limited to 'pango/pango-font.h')
-rw-r--r-- | pango/pango-font.h |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/pango/pango-font.h b/pango/pango-font.h index 4750300d..f9cabfb3 100644 --- a/pango/pango-font.h +++ b/pango/pango-font.h @@ -241,6 +241,9 @@ GType pango_font_face_get_type (void) G_GNUC_CONST; PangoFontDescription *pango_font_face_describe (PangoFontFace *face); G_CONST_RETURN char *pango_font_face_get_face_name (PangoFontFace *face); +void pango_font_face_list_sizes (PangoFontFace *face, + int **sizes, + int *n_sizes); #ifdef PANGO_ENABLE_BACKEND @@ -263,11 +266,13 @@ struct _PangoFontFaceClass const char * (*get_face_name) (PangoFontFace *face); PangoFontDescription * (*describe) (PangoFontFace *face); + void (*list_sizes) (PangoFontFace *face, + int **sizes, + int *n_sizes); /*< private >*/ /* Padding for future expansion */ - void (*_pango_reserved1) (void); void (*_pango_reserved2) (void); void (*_pango_reserved3) (void); void (*_pango_reserved4) (void); |